Case Study

Teak is a Thoroughbred/Paint cross mare who was inseminated on 17th January 2017 and is due between the 14th and 24th December 2017. She is in foal to the Tobiano Black Homozygous American stallion Lil More Conclusive.

The case study follows the last few weeks of Teak’s pregnancy, starting on 2nd November 2017.
